Ratings for Stoke Therapeutics (NASDAQ:STOK) were provided by 5 analysts in the past three months, showcasing a mix of bullish and bearish perspectives.

The following table encapsulates their recent ratings, offering a glimpse into the evolving sentiments over the past 30 days and comparing them to the preceding months.

Bullish Somewhat Bullish Indifferent Somewhat Bearish Bearish
Total Ratings 3 2 0 0 0
Last 30D 0 1 0 0 0
1M Ago 0 0 0 0 0
2M Ago 2 1 0 0 0
3M Ago 1 0 0 0 0

The 12-month price targets, analyzed by analysts, offer insights with an average target of $39.4, a high estimate of $50.00, and a low estimate of $35.00. Witnessing a positive shift, the current average has risen by 32.44% from the previous average price target of $29.75.

Diving into Analyst Ratings: An In-Depth Exploration

In examining recent analyst actions, we gain insights into how financial experts perceive Stoke Therapeutics. The following summary outlines key analysts, their recent evaluations, and adjustments to ratings and price targets.

Analyst Analyst Firm Action Taken Rating Current Price Target Prior Price Target
Rudy Li Wolfe Research Announces Outperform $40.00 -
Laura Chico Wedbush Raises Outperform $36.00 $32.00
Keay Nakae Chardan Capital Raises Buy $35.00 $24.00
Sumant Kulkarni Canaccord Genuity Raises Buy $36.00 $28.00
Ananda Ghosh HC Wainwright & Co. Raises Buy $50.00 $35.00

Get to Know Stoke Therapeutics Better

Stoke Therapeutics Inc is a biotechnology company dedicated to restoring protein expression by harnessing the body's potential with RNA medicine. Its proprietary TANGO (Targeted Augmentation of Nuclear Gene Output) approach, Stoke is developing antisense oligonucleotides (ASOs) to restore naturally-occurring protein levels selectively. Its first medicine in development, zorevunersen, has demonstrated the potential for disease modification in patients with Dravet syndrome. The company provides early programs focused on multiple targets, including haploinsufficiency diseases of the central nervous system and eye, to up-regulate the protein expression of the underlying disease gene in a mutation-agnostic manner.

How Are Analyst Ratings Determined?

Within the domain of banking and financial systems, analysts specialize in reporting for specific stocks or defined sectors. Their work involves attending company conference calls and meetings, researching company financial statements, and communicating with insiders to publish "analyst ratings" for stocks. Analysts typically assess and rate each stock once per quarter.

Some analysts publish their predictions for metrics such as growth estimates, earnings, and revenue to provide additional guidance with their ratings. When using analyst ratings, it is important to keep in mind that stock and sector analysts are also human and are only offering their opinions to investors.
